Weldon L. Burden, 83, of Sawyer, passed away, Monday, February 11, 2013 at Advocate Christ Medical Center in Oak Lawn, Illinois. Private graveside services will be held with Military Rites conducted by Wright-Patterson Air Force Base Military Rites Team, at Ruggles Cemetery in Baroda. Those wishing to sign Weldon’s Memory book online may do so at www.starks-menchinger.com. Weldon was born May 1, 1929 in Benton Harbor to Warren & Minnie (Kieser) Burden. He graduated from Stevensville High School in 1947, attended Benton Harbor Junior College, received his Bachelor’s in Aeronautical Engineering from the Air Force Institute of Technology, and his Master’s Degree from the University of Maryland. Weldon served his country in the United States Air Force during the Korean and Vietnam Wars. He retired with the rank of Major after twenty years of service. Weldon received several awards and medals including the Distinguished Flying Cross while flying 165 combat missions and logging 9800 hours of flight time. He also served as a test pilot for a variety of aircraft including the C-5A Galaxy. Weldon was active with Lest We Forget where he was able to show his love for the United States and his Patriotism. In his free time, he enjoyed reading, gardening and the South Shore Concert Band. Weldon is survived by his wife of sixty years-Maureen (Hinckley) Burden; his children-Robin Allen of St. Joseph, Rick (Rosanne) Burden of Stevensville, Chris Burden of Sawyer, Nicole (Richard) Greter of Portage, MI; three grandchildren-Zane (Amelia) Burden, Katharine & Emmaline Greter; and numerous nieces & nephews. He was preceded in death by his parents and by his siblings-Glen Burden, Gertrude Steele, Velda Hucko & Lois Burden.
